User-centric medical care hasn’t always been a priority for healthcare providers and organizations. But today, with a smartphone in every pocket, access to limitless resources through the internet, and research available at the click of a button, patient expectations are changing rapidly. They are demanding more transparency and convenience from providers. They expect to engage with healthcare organizations using the same digital tools that power numerous other aspects of their lives.
